Competition/Ranked gamemode (X-post with N++ Reddit)
Posted: 2016.02.20 (08:12)
First off, I wanna mention that Raigan had already posted about a similar idea that they are working on.
I do not know if this idea is realistic at this point, but I am just throwing it out there.
So, the idea.
A new option will be added to the main menu, this option will be called something like "Ranked".
Ranked got a main stand-alone leaderboard, more on that later.
Everyday, a new level will be added to the ranked playlist, this level will stay active for 7 days, this means that at every given time, 7 levels will be active and playable.
In these 7 days, players will be able to climb the level's leaderboards on these levels, however, they cannot watch the replays of other players, the reason for that is to keep it a true competition of who can find the best route + who can execute that route the best.
After these 7 days, the level will be deactivated. And at the same time, all 20 players will receive points:
0th - 20 points
1st - 19 points
2nd - 18 points
And so on...
All points that a player receives will be counted towards his/her total amount of points. That's where the main Ranked leaderboard comes in: here, players will be ranked by the total amount of points they have gained from playing the ranked levels.
A new level everyday seems like a lot of work though, maybe a new one every 3 days would be fine as well? Or let the community submit maps? Not sure.
This kind of works like a built-in 'NPoints competition' people who play Nv2 probably know what I'm talking about :)
